Improving employee performance with OKRS
Since the 1950s, business leaders have embraced a variety of management techniques designed to improve employee performance. In 1999, John Doerr introduced Objectives – Key Results (OKRs) to Google, a model he first learned about at Intel, and revolutionized goal setting. Today, OKRs are a de facto standard for aligning company and individual goals.
